Transaction 103f67e86307316c2df86f661d3100242884271a530f05812a23b219b62952e3
1 Input
2 Outputs
- 103f67e86307316c2df86f661d3100242884271a530f05812a23b219b62952e3:0
- 103f67e86307316c2df86f661d3100242884271a530f05812a23b219b62952e3:1
value 5307862
address 14JTyJXyEtfxLrAMnsSgm8Eh7oB55JrYPR
value 2254740643
address 1HHiKp6WFVFhQdAZM3HUP2SFmoBrMNdsGM